In Shakespeare's The Tempest, Prospero's brother Antonio robs him of his dukedom and sets him and his daughter Miranda adrift to
die. They survive, and years later Prospero magically causes Antonio and others to become shipwrecked on the island. After a series of elaborate events, Prospero gets his dukedom back, Antonio apologizes, and all is reconciled. Which words below come closest to summarizing the two themes this scenario illustrates?
Explanation: In literature, the theme is the underlying message of a story, it is what critical belief about life is the author trying to convey in the writing of a novel, play, short story or poem. Usually this belief, or idea, is universal and transcends cultural barriers. In the given excerpt we can see developed the theme of betrayal, because Antonio tries to kill his brother Prospero, and also the theme of forgiveness, because at the end, Prospero forgives Antonio.
